Background

The Mission Investment Fund of the ELCA (MIF), a financial ministry of the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America (ELCA), supports the establishment and growth of congregations and other church-affiliated ministries by providing financing for building projects. MIF also offers socially responsible investment products to both individuals and ministries, the proceeds of which fund the loan program and provide investors with financial returns.

The ELCA Federal Credit Union (ELCA FCU), a financial ministry partner of the Mission Investment Fund, offers financial products and services to members, pastors, congregations, synods, affiliated ministries, and their employees. The portfolio of products includes low-cost loans, deposit accounts, credit cards, and other solutions within a not-for-profit, cooperative structure.
